I purchased this item (after seeing the infomercial) specifically for cooking small portions. It has worked well for that purpose and has a small footprint. It is especially helpful for singles and those on a diet who don't want loads of leftovers. I have tried several recipes from the book as well as "shake and bake" pork chops. The pork chops turned out very tender and juicy, although I will be turning them over if I do them again, since foods only brown well (crisp) if they touch both the top and bottom surface. Egg dishes turn out well, but I haven't had as much luck with the "possible pie." They have a "larger" one for sale and offered it when I ordered it, but I only wanted something very small.

Customer Review: Stay AS FAR AWAY from GT Direct as you can get! Summary: 1 Stars
I bought two of the GT Express Cookers from a TV infomercial. They tried to UP-Sell a tone of stuff when placing the order.
The product was advertised at $19.95 ea. Which is OK but when the product & invoice arrived, I couldn't believe my eyes.
Here ya go:
GTX 2 pack Original With bonus = $39.90 (Which included recipe booklets)
GTX recipe collection shipping = $9.95
So Far = $49.85
Postage & Handling = $33.85 (WOW)
Total = $83.70
The units works OK (I only cook eggs in it) but it costs a whole lot more than $19.95. By the way, my gas range cooks eggs a lot faster than the seven minutes this thing takes.
